Kinross Road is in Fazakerley, Liverpool and in Liverpool district. L10 1LH is located in the Fazakerley East elect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Liverpool, Walton.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Kinross Road was 134.1 per 1,000 residents, which is 12.8% higher than the Fazakerley East average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.
Kinross Road has the 5th highest crime rate of 25 local areas in Fazakerley East and the 471st highest crime rate of 1,552 local areas in Liverpool .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 47.5 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-36.5%.
